Chandigarh, June 11
Chief Minister Manohar Lal Khattar has approved construction of six nursing colleges at a cost Rs 194.3 crore in various districts of the state. The colleges will be constructed in 15 months.
Giving details, an official spokesman said two nursing colleges would be constructed in Faridabad (Dayalpur and Aura) and one each in Rewari (Sadat Nagar), Kaithal (Dherdu), Kurukshetra (Kheri Ram Nagar) and Panchkula (Kherawali) districts.
He said the land for setting up these colleges had already been leased out to the Department of Medical Education and Research. He said the concept plan for each nursing institute had been prepared and approved.
